Understanding Semaglutide Medication for Weight Loss

Semaglutide is a GLP-1 medication that has become a popular choice for weight loss. It is the same active ingredient found in brand-name options like Wegovy and Ozempic. Originally used for managing type 2 diabetes, semaglutide has shown remarkable results in helping people lose weight by controlling appetite and supporting healthier eating habits.

How It Works in Your Body

Semaglutide mimics a natural hormone called GLP-1. This hormone has several effects that help with weight loss. It slows down how quickly food leaves the stomach, helping you feel full longer. It also influences the brain’s appetite centers so you do not feel as hungry throughout the day.

This makes it easier to make better food choices and avoid constant snacking. Instead of relying on willpower alone, patients feel like they have more control over their eating.

A Safe Option for Many Patients

One reason Dr. Johnson likes semaglutide medication for weight loss is because of its safety profile. Like any medication, it is not completely free of side effects, but for most people, they are mild and manageable.

The most common side effect is nausea, especially when starting treatment. That can sound unpleasant, but there is good news. Doctors have found that starting at a lower dose and increasing slowly over time helps the body adjust. This approach reduces the chance of nausea being a big issue.

Balancing Risks and Benefits

It is true that any weight loss medication needs to be weighed carefully against potential risks. But for many patients struggling with obesity and metabolic syndrome, the risks of doing nothing are even greater.

Metabolic syndrome brings with it a higher chance of heart disease, stroke, and type 2 diabetes. Carrying extra weight can make blood pressure and cholesterol harder to manage. By helping patients lose weight and adopt healthier habits, semaglutide helps reduce these risks.

When used with proper medical supervision, the benefits of semaglutide often outweigh the risks, making it a reasonable choice for many.
